Understanding the Financial Mechanics: How Exporters Handle Logistics Operation Payments

XTransfer

2026-04-27

Executing global trade requires far more than manufacturing a product and securing a buyer; it demands a highly orchestrated synchronization of physical goods movement and financial liquidity. Navigating the settlement of ocean freight, air cargo consolidation, customs duties, terminal handling charges, and last-mile drayage presents a complex financial puzzle. The precision with which these financial obligations are settled dictates the speed of the physical supply chain. A delayed telegraphic transfer can result in a held bill of lading, subsequently triggering thousands of dollars in port demurrage penalties. Consequently, analyzing how exporters handle logistics operation payments becomes critical for optimizing working capital, maintaining vendor relationships with freight forwarders, and protecting profit margins from currency volatility and intermediary banking friction.

The architecture of cross-border freight settlement is inherently fragmented. A single container shipped from Shenzhen to Rotterdam under Delivered Duty Paid (DDP) terms may require separate financial disbursements to an ocean carrier in United States Dollars, a European customs broker in Euros, and a local trucking syndicate in local currency. Each of these nodes operates on distinct credit terms, compliance frameworks, and reconciliation protocols. Trade finance professionals must continuously evaluate counterparty risk, route capital efficiently through correspondent banking networks, and structure their accounts payable departments to align with maritime transport schedules. This deep technical intersection of treasury management and supply chain execution forms the foundation of modern global commerce.

What Financial Instruments Are Deployed When Considering How Exporters Handle Logistics Operation Payments?

Determining the appropriate financial vehicle for freight settlement requires balancing transaction velocity against banking costs and counterparty security. Sellers rarely rely on a singular method for all transport-related disbursements; rather, they segment their payable structures based on the specific service provider. Major ocean carriers and global third-party logistics (3PL) providers generally mandate rigid payment schedules, often requiring cleared funds before issuing the original Bill of Lading or executing a telex release. This creates an immediate demand for high-velocity transaction instruments capable of traversing international borders without triggering extensive compliance holds. When analyzing the core of how exporters handle logistics operation payments, the reliance on the SWIFT network remains historically dominant, though the integration of localized clearing networks is rapidly altering treasury operations.

Documentary collections and Letters of Credit (LC) also play a peripheral but vital role in freight settlement, particularly when transport costs are bundled into the commercial value of the goods under Cost, Insurance, and Freight (CIF) terms. In such scenarios, the freight forwarder's invoice might be settled by the negotiating bank upon the presentation of clean shipping documents. However, for direct payments to logistics vendors, open account terms paired with scheduled wire transfers are the industry standard for established commercial relationships. The underlying challenge remains the unpredictability of lifting fees, correspondent banking deductions, and the opacity of the transaction lifecycle.

Evaluating SWIFT Telegraphic Transfers for Freight Forwarders

The SWIFT MT103 message format serves as the backbone for international transport settlements. When an enterprise initiates a telegraphic transfer to an overseas Non-Vessel Operating Common Carrier (NVOCC), the funds often traverse multiple correspondent banks before crediting the beneficiary. Enterprises must meticulously select charge codes—typically opting for 'OUR' to ensure the logistics provider receives the exact invoiced amount, preventing disputes over short payments that could delay cargo release. However, SWIFT transfers inherently carry a T+2 settlement cycle, meaning treasury departments must forecast port arrival dates and initiate wires well in advance of vessel discharge to avoid supply chain bottlenecks.

Utilizing Local Clearing Networks for Customs and Warehousing

To circumvent the latency and expense of international wire transfers, sophisticated trade operators increasingly tap into localized clearing systems. By leveraging entities that provide access to domestic payment rails—such as the Automated Clearing House (ACH) in the United States or the Single Euro Payments Area (SEPA) in Europe—enterprises can settle warehousing fees, local drayage, and import duties as if they were a domiciled domestic entity. This architectural shift significantly compresses the payment timeline from days to hours, eliminating intermediary banking deductions and providing exact certainty of the landed cost for tax and duty disbursements.

How Do Exchange Rate Volatility and Currency Mismatches Affect Supply Chain Costs?

The maritime shipping industry predominantly invoices deep-sea freight in United States Dollars, regardless of the origin or destination of the cargo. This structural reliance on the USD creates immediate foreign exchange (FX) exposure for sellers operating in diverse local currencies. If a manufacturer prices its commercial goods based on a specific exchange rate, but the domestic currency depreciates against the USD during the transit period, the localized cost of the ocean freight invoice will surge, directly eroding the net profit margin of the transaction. Treasury departments must deploy robust hedging strategies to lock in freight costs at the time of order confirmation, rather than absorbing spot rate volatility at the time of vessel departure.

Beyond the primary ocean freight, localized logistics operations—such as destination terminal handling charges (DTHC), customs inspections, and regional warehousing—are universally billed in the currency of the destination port. This introduces cross-currency pair complexities. An enterprise exporting to the United Kingdom might receive commercial payment in British Pounds, owe ocean freight in US Dollars, and face origin port fees in Chinese Yuan. Managing these divergent liquidity streams without incurring excessive spread markups requires a sophisticated treasury policy. Sellers must maintain multi-currency holding balances, allowing them to route payments naturally without forcing unnecessary and costly currency conversions for every individual logistics invoice.

Furthermore, timing discrepancies exacerbate FX risk. Freight forwarders frequently issue invoices with a very narrow payment window, sometimes demanding settlement within 48 hours of vessel departure. If this window coincides with a period of high macroeconomic volatility—such as central bank interest rate adjustments or geopolitical instability—the forced execution of a spot market currency exchange can result in severe financial penalization. Strategic treasury teams counter this by executing forward contracts specifically earmarked for anticipated logistics payables, ensuring that the financial mechanics of physical transport remain insulated from macroeconomic market swings.

Which Data Points Dictate the Efficiency of Cross-Border Freight Settlements?

Analyzing the sheer volume of data involved in routing capital to transport providers reveals significant variances in operational efficiency. Different settlement vehicles offer vastly different profiles regarding speed, documentary burden, and risk. The choice of settlement mechanism directly influences the administrative overhead borne by the accounts payable team. To quantify these operational realities, the following matrix outlines specific metrics associated with distinct financial routing entities.

Settlement Entity / MethodProcessing Time (Hours)Document RequirementsTypical FX SpreadChargeback Risk
Wire Transfer via SWIFT Network24 - 72 HoursCommercial Invoice, Bill of Lading, Contract1.5% - 3.0% (Variable by Bank)Extremely Low (Irrevocable)
Local Currency Collection Account (SEPA/ACH)1 - 12 HoursBasic Waybill, Local Tax ID0.3% - 1.0% (Interbank linked)Low (Regulated domestic rails)
Documentary Letter of Credit (Sight)72 - 120 Hours (Post-presentation)Strict compliance with LC terms (UCP 600)Negotiated at LC issuanceZero (Bank guaranteed upon clean documents)
Corporate Purchasing Cards (Virtual)Instant AuthorizationDigital Invoice Generation2.0% - 4.0% (Including merchant fees)Moderate (Subject to card network rules)

Evaluating this data allows finance directors to construct a layered approach to logistics disbursements. Urgent telex releases might justify the higher friction of an expedited wire, whereas routine monthly warehousing consolidation bills are better suited for localized domestic routing. The architectural configuration of these routing choices profoundly impacts the overarching agility of the enterprise's physical distribution network.

Evaluating How Exporters Handle Logistics Operation Payments Through Multi-Currency Invoicing Structures

The expansion of global supply chains has normalized the practice of multi-currency invoicing within a single transport lifecycle. A seller orchestrating a complex multimodal shipment might contract a master freight forwarder who subsequently subcontracts regional operations. The resulting invoice structure is heavily layered: ocean freight in USD, European rail transport in EUR, and destination port clearance in localized fiat. Navigating this fragmented billing environment requires an accounts payable infrastructure capable of intelligent currency routing. When examining how exporters handle logistics operation payments under these conditions, the fundamental objective is avoiding double-conversion scenarios where funds are needlessly exchanged from the origin currency to a base currency, and then again into the final beneficiary's local currency.

By maintaining segregated currency balances, enterprises can collect export revenues in foreign fiat and immediately repurpose those exact currencies to settle specific logistics obligations in the same denomination. This strategy, known as natural hedging, systematically eliminates the foreign exchange spread from the logistics cost equation, preserving tighter margins on low-value, high-volume commodities.

Structuring Milestone Disbursements for Third-Party Logistics Providers

Complex logistics contracts, particularly those involving project cargo or extended warehousing agreements, are rarely settled through lump-sum transactions. Instead, treasurers structure milestone-based disbursement schedules. An initial mobilization fee might be routed via a local clearing network to secure warehouse capacity, followed by a substantial USD wire transfer upon the issuance of the 'Shipped on Board' bill of lading. Final reconciliation payments for variable costs, such as unanticipated customs inspection fees or palletization charges, are held back until final delivery. This phased liquidity injection protects the seller against non-performance while ensuring the transport provider maintains sufficient cash flow to execute the physical movement of goods.

Why Do Anti-Money Laundering Regulations Cause Unpredictable Interventions in Freight Clearances?

The intersection of physical trade and international finance is heavily monitored by global regulatory bodies aiming to prevent illicit capital flows, enforce geopolitical sanctions, and combat trade-based money laundering (TBML). Consequently, financial institutions subject every cross-border transport payment to rigorous automated screening processes. A crucial aspect of how exporters handle logistics operation payments involves navigating these compliance frameworks to prevent legitimate freight settlements from being frozen in correspondent banking transit accounts. When a bank's algorithmic compliance engine flags a transaction, the resulting manual review can stall a payment for weeks, directly halting cargo release at the destination port.

Sanctions screening is particularly stringent in maritime logistics. Banks cross-reference the names of the vessels, the registered owners of the shipping lines, the port of loading, and the port of discharge against continually updated lists maintained by authorities such as the Office of Foreign Assets Control (OFAC). If a seller initiates a payment to a freight forwarder who has unknowingly chartered a vessel with complex, obscured ownership tied to a sanctioned entity, the payment will be blocked. Enterprises must conduct proactive due diligence, utilizing sophisticated tracking databases to verify the compliance status of the physical transport assets before initiating any financial settlement.

Aligning Commercial Invoices with Bills of Lading for Bank Audits

Trade-based money laundering often involves the manipulation of invoices—over-invoicing, under-invoicing, or phantom shipments—to move capital illegally across borders. To combat this, banks frequently request supporting documentation before releasing large freight settlements. Discrepancies between the commercial invoice (detailing the goods and their value) and the Bill of Lading (detailing the physical weight and container numbers) are immediate red flags. A container manifested with heavy industrial machinery but invoiced for a trivial commercial amount will trigger intense scrutiny. Treasury teams must ensure absolute data symmetry across all supply chain documentation; the weights, descriptions, and counterparty details must align perfectly to satisfy the rigorous evidentiary demands of the banking sector's compliance auditors.

How Do Incoterms Shape the Liability and Cash Flow Mechanics of Transport Invoicing?

International Commercial Terms (Incoterms) published by the International Chamber of Commerce are not merely legal definitions of risk transfer; they are the architectural blueprints for supply chain cash flow. The specific three-letter acronym negotiated in a sales contract dictates precisely which party is responsible for funding each distinct leg of the international journey. Incoterms fundamentally restructure how exporters handle logistics operation payments by defining the exact geographical point where the financial burden shifts from the seller to the buyer. Understanding this correlation is imperative for accurate working capital forecasting and treasury allocation.

Under Free on Board (FOB) terms, the seller's financial obligation is theoretically limited to the origin port. They must finance the inland drayage, origin terminal handling charges, and export customs clearance. Once the cargo crosses the ship's rail, the ocean freight invoice and all subsequent destination charges are routed directly to the buyer. This structure heavily reduces the seller's foreign exchange exposure and minimizes their direct interaction with deep-sea freight forwarders. However, it also relinquishes control over the maritime transport network, potentially exposing the seller's inventory to longer transit times dictated by the buyer's choice of carrier.

Conversely, Delivered Duty Paid (DDP) terms represent the maximum financial burden for the seller. Under DDP, the seller must orchestrate and fund the entire logistics continuum: origin processing, international freight, destination port handling, import duties, applicable value-added taxes (VAT), and final inland delivery. This requires massive liquidity outlays long before the buyer settles the commercial invoice. Sellers operating under DDP must establish intricate accounts payable networks in foreign jurisdictions, often requiring the deployment of customs bonds and localized tax disbursement mechanisms. The sheer volume of individual invoices generated under a DDP shipment necessitates highly automated reconciliation software to prevent cost overruns from eroding the profitability of the entire trade transaction.

What Are the Repercussions of Delayed Remittances on Demurrage and Detention Penalties?

In the maritime logistics ecosystem, time translates directly into severe financial penalties. Ports and shipping lines operate on strict asset utilization models; empty containers must be returned, and terminal space must be cleared for incoming vessels. When cargo sits idle at a destination port, it accumulates demurrage charges (fees levied by the terminal for utilizing port space beyond the allotted free time) and detention charges (fees levied by the carrier for holding the physical container beyond the agreed period). These fees compound daily and can rapidly exceed the commercial value of the underlying goods.

The primary catalyst for these idle cargo scenarios is localized friction in the freight settlement process. Shipping lines explicitly refuse to issue a Delivery Order (D/O)—the critical document required for a trucking syndicate to extract the container from the terminal—until all outstanding ocean freight and destination charges are cleared in their accounts. If a seller initiates a cross-border wire transfer on a Friday afternoon, and the funds are caught in a correspondent banking compliance queue over the weekend, the cargo remains immobilized. This delay illustrates precisely why how exporters handle logistics operation payments directly impacts the accrual of punitive supply chain fees. Treasury departments must maintain proactive communication protocols with logistics providers, utilizing MT103 SWIFT tracking reports to provide cryptographic proof of payment initiation, sometimes allowing freight forwarders to authorize conditional cargo releases prior to the final clearing of funds.

Furthermore, disputes over supplementary logistics charges frequently cause payment stalemates. A freight forwarder might issue a final invoice containing unanticipated peak season surcharges (PSS) or general rate increases (GRI). If the seller's accounts payable department disputes these line items and halts the entire settlement, the cargo remains trapped, generating massive demurrage bills. Sophisticated supply chain operators mitigate this by implementing 'pay and dispute' policies—settling the invoice immediately to release the cargo and halt the accrual of port penalties, then initiating a post-delivery audit and reconciliation process to recover any overbilled amounts.

How Can Working Capital Constraints Be Mitigated During Peak Shipping Seasons?

The cyclical nature of global trade, characterized by immense volume spikes preceding major consumer holidays, places extraordinary strain on corporate liquidity. During these peak seasons, freight rates historically surge, and carriers rigidly enforce strict credit limits. Enterprises find large portions of their working capital tied up in floating inventory—goods that have been manufactured and shipped but will not be paid for by the end buyer for 60 to 90 days. Concurrently, logistics providers demand immediate settlement for their inflated transport services. Bridging this specific cash flow chasm requires advanced trade finance interventions.

Supply chain finance and logistics factoring have emerged as critical tools for maintaining operational velocity. Rather than depleting internal cash reserves to pay ocean freight invoices, sellers can leverage third-party financiers who inject immediate liquidity into the transport network. In a typical logistics factoring arrangement, the financier settles the freight forwarder's invoice directly upon vessel departure, providing the seller with an extended 60-day repayment window. While this incurs a financing fee, it preserves the enterprise's core working capital, allowing them to fund ongoing manufacturing operations while the physical goods are in transit.

Alternatively, some global logistics conglomerates now embed financial services directly into their digital freight forwarding platforms. By analyzing the seller's historical shipping data, customs records, and commercial buyer creditworthiness, these platforms can dynamically underwrite the transport transaction. They extend deferred payment terms on ocean freight, essentially operating as both the physical carrier and the credit provider. This deep integration of logistics execution and working capital provision significantly simplifies the treasury workflow, consolidating the physical and financial supply chains into a single, highly visible dashboard.

What Role Does Digitization Play in Accelerating Bill of Lading Releases?

The historical reliance on physical paper documents—specifically the original Bill of Lading—has long been a major bottleneck in international trade settlement. Traditionally, a seller would pay the ocean freight, receive three original paper copies of the Bill of Lading via international courier, endorse them, and courier them again to the buyer or the negotiating bank. This physical movement of paper across oceans takes days, heavily delaying the potential for cargo release and extending the cash conversion cycle.

The transition toward electronic Bills of Lading (eBL) fundamentally alters this paradigm. Operating on secure, often blockchain-based cryptographic ledgers, eBLs allow for the instantaneous transfer of title and ownership once specific financial conditions are met. When integrated with modern API-driven banking infrastructure, the payment of a freight invoice can automatically trigger a smart contract that instantly transfers the eBL to the destination party. This complete synchronization of the payment layer with the documentary layer eliminates the transit time of paper, reduces the risk of document loss or fraud, and allows cargo to be processed at destination ports with unprecedented velocity. The digitalization of these core transport documents represents a massive leap forward in streamlining the administrative burden of global trade operations.

Strategic Evaluations of How Exporters Handle Logistics Operation Payments

Mastering the financial architecture of physical distribution is no longer a peripheral administrative task; it is a core component of competitive strategy in global commerce. The landscape of cross-border trade is characterized by extreme macroeconomic volatility, shifting regulatory compliance mandates, and unpredictable supply chain disruptions. In this environment, the efficiency of an enterprise's treasury operations directly dictates its ability to deliver goods reliably and profitably. From navigating the complexities of SWIFT routing and local clearing networks to mitigating foreign exchange exposure and preventing demurrage penalties, every financial decision ripples through the physical supply chain.

Enterprises must move away from reactive accounts payable models and adopt highly strategic, deeply integrated trade finance frameworks. By leveraging advanced payment infrastructures, intelligent multi-currency routing, and rigorous compliance documentation protocols, organizations can transform their logistics disbursements from a source of operational friction into a distinct competitive advantage. A precise understanding of the interplay between Incoterms, customs regulations, and banking settlement cycles enables sellers to protect their margins, strengthen vendor relationships, and optimize their working capital. Ultimately, how exporters handle logistics operation payments determines the resilience, agility, and fundamental profitability of their entire global footprint.
